>running a draw play where you fake like you are running the ball and draw the >fast players in, and then at the last second you throw the ball.

Technically, a draw play is where the linemen pass block for a short time (my
old high school team pass blocked for two seconds), and the quarterback acts
like he is going to pass. At the last second, he hands off to a running back,
and the linemen then run block.

Faking a running play and then throwing the ball is known as a play action pass,
and is basically the exact opposite of a draw.
